html, body, div, span, applet, object, iframe,
h1, h2, h3, h4, h5, h6, p, blockquote, pre,
a, abbr, acronym, address, big, cite, code,
del, dfn, em, font, img, ins, kbd, q, s, samp,
small, strike, strong, sub, sup, tt, var,
b, u, i, center,
dl, dt, dd, ol, ul, li,
fieldset, form, label, legend,
table, caption, tbody, tfoot, thead, tr, th, td {
	margin: 0;
	padding: 0;
	border: 0;
	outline: 0;
	font-size: 100%;
	vertical-align: baseline;
	background: transparent;
}
body {line-height: 1;}
ol, ul {list-style: none;}
blockquote, q {quotes: none;}
blockquote:before, blockquote:after, q:before, q:after {content: ''; content: none;}
:focus {outline: 0;}
ins {text-decoration: none;}
del {text-decoration: line-through;}
/* tables still need 'cellspacing="0"' in the markup */
table {border-collapse: collapse;border-spacing: 0;}
b, strong {font-weight: bold;}
i, em {font-style: italic;}



/* GO!!! */

body {background: black url(/img/bg.jpg) no-repeat top center; font-family: 'Arial';}
a {color: #0c95ff;}
hr {margin: 25px 0 25px 0;}
#page {width: 780px; margin: 0 auto 0 auto;}
#main {background-color: white;}
.clear {clear: both;}
.center {text-align: center;}
.nowrap {white-space:nowrap;}
.red {color: red;}
.bold {font-weight: bold;}
.small {font-size: 80%;}

/* header + menu*/

.headerbig {
text-align: center;
color: white;
font: bold italic 50px 'Georgia';
margin-top: 10px;}
.tel {
text-align: center;
color: white;
margin: 10px 0 0 0;}
.t1 {font-size: 40px; font-weight: bold;}
.cards {vertical-align: -5px; margin-left: 30px;}
.t2 {font-size: 30px; vertical-align: 3px;}
.t3 {font-size: 25px;}
#header {
text-align:center;
list-style:none;}
#header LI {
display:inline-block;
margin:0 -2px;
vertical-align:top;}
#header LI A {
display:inline-block;
margin:0 13px 0 0;
padding:5px 15px;
color:gray;
font-size: 21px;
vertical-align:bottom;}
#header LI A:hover {color: black;}
@-moz-document url-prefix() {
#content LI {display:-moz-inline-grid;display:inline-block;} /*For FF2 only*/
#content LI {margin:0 -2px;} /*For FF*/
#content LI, x:-moz-any-link, x:default {margin:0 -2px;} /*For FF3*/}
#menu {margin: 7px 0 30px 0;}
#toptext {height: 250px; width: 460px; overflow: hidden; padding: 0 0 0 300px; margin: 37px 0 0 0;}
#toptext p {font-family: georgia; margin: 0 0 10px 0; overflow: hidden; text-align: left; line-height: 140%; font-size: 120%; text-shadow: white 0 0 10px, white 0 0 10px;}
#toptext p b{white-space:nowrap; text-shadow: white 0 0 10px, white 0 0 10px, white 0 0 15px, white 0 0 15px;}

/* columns */
#lateral, #content {float: left;}
#lateral {width: 200px; margin: 0 30px 20px 20px; padding: 10px; background: #eeeeee;}
#content {width: 480px;}
#lateral {
border-radius:10px;
-moz-border-radius:10px;
-webkit-border-radius:10px;
}

#lateral li {margin: 0 0 18px 0;}
#lateral li a {font-size: 100%; font-weight: normal; color: #444444;}
#lateral li a:hover {color: black;}

h1, h2, h3 {font-weight: normal;}
#content h1 {font-size: 230%; margin: 0 0 30px 0;}
#content h2 {font-size: 190%; margin: 30px 0 20px 0;}
#content h3 {font-size: 150%; margin: 30px 0 20px 0;}
#content p {line-height: 140%; margin: 0 0 10px 0;}


/* form */

div.formunit {
border: 2px solid red;
background: #eeeeee;
padding: 10px;
margin: 20px 0 20px 0;
border-radius:10px;
-moz-border-radius:10px;
-webkit-border-radius:10px;
}

body #content div.formunit p {
margin: 20px 0 20px 0;
font-size: 90%;
}

.formunit .form2, .formunit .form1  {float: left; display: block;}
.formunit .form1 {width: 150px;}
.formunit .form2 {width: 150px;}

#content div.formunit h3 {margin-top: 20px;}

/* footer */

#footer {
text-align: center;
background:	#eee;
padding: 15px 0 15px 0;}

#footer a {color: #3091bc;}
.f1 {font-size: 12px; font-weight: bold; margin-bottom: 8px}
.f2 {font-size: 10px;}



/* hide dublicates */


li.page-item-12,
li.page-item-15,
li.page-item-17,
li.page-item-34,
li.page-item-36,
li.page-item-69,
li.page-item-74,
li.page-item-96,
li.page-item-100,
li.page-item-107,
li.page-item-80,
li.page-item-83,
li.page-item-90,
li.page-item-109,
li.page-item-58,
li.page-item-112,
li.page-item-71,
li.page-item-115,
li.page-item-62,
li.page-item-93,
li.page-item-77 {
display: none;
}